% File : GEO103-1 : TPTP v8.2.0. Released v2.4.0.
% Domain : Geometry (Oriented curves)
% Problem : Common endpoint of subcurves and another point means inclusion
% Version : [EHK99] axioms.
% English : If two sub-curves of an open curve have a common endpoint and
% another point in common, then one of the two sub-curves is
% included in the other.
% Refs : [KE99] Kulik & Eschenbach (1999), A Geometry of Oriented Curv
% : [EHK99] Eschenbach et al. (1999), Representing Simple Trajecto
% Source : [TPTP]
